The Georgia Department of Corrections has contracted with Cornell Corrections and Corrections Corporation of America to operate three private prisons located throughout the state. D. Ray James Prison located in Folkston, Georgia is operated by Cornell Corrections. Coffee Correctional Institute located in Nicholls, Georgia and Wheeler Correctional Institute located in Alamo, Georgia are operated by Corrections Corporation of America.


The Department has assigned a team of specialists to monitor the daily operation of each of the three private facilities and ensure that the terms of the contracts are being met. Employees at the facilities include security personnel (certified by the Georgia Peace Officer Standards and Training Council), counselors, program specialists and support staff. Programming for inmate vocational, educational and substance abuse treatment closely follow the standards found in state-operated facilities.

He probably needs to talk to his counselor and have them get with records to check on dates. Was he held on any type of probation violation or other charges that were dropped before is conviction? A lot of times if he had misdemenors that were sentenced to time served the the DOC does not allow that to count toward the state time. Just giving a few possibilities, or sometimes human error is involved so tell him to keep after the counselor, most of the time they will not discuss this with anyone other than the inmate so he will have to handle the paperwork.
